教你用jquery实现iframe自适应高度


Posted in Javascript onJune 11, 2014

iframe代码,注意要写ID

<iframe src="test.html" id="main" width="700" height="300" frameborder="0" scrolling="auto"></iframe>

jquery代码一:

//注意:下面的代码是放在test.html调用 
$(window.parent.document).find("#main").load(function(){ 
var main = $(window.parent.document).find("#main"); 
var thisheight = $(document).height()+30; 
main.height(thisheight); 
});

jquery代码二:

//注意:下面的代码是放在和iframe同一个页面调用 
$("#main").load(function(){ 
var mainheight = $(this).contents().find("body").height()+30; 
$(this).height(mainheight); 
});
Javascript 相关文章推荐
如何使用json在前后台进行数据传输实例介绍
Apr 11 Javascript
让jQuery与其他JavaScript库并存避免冲突的方法
Dec 23 Javascript
instanceof和typeof运算符的区别详解
Jan 06 Javascript
jQuery对下拉框,单选框,多选框的操作
Feb 21 Javascript
完美兼容各大浏览器获取HTTP_REFERER方法总结
Jun 24 Javascript
实例讲解使用原生JavaScript处理AJAX请求的方法
May 10 Javascript
url传递的参数值中包含&amp;时,url自动截断问题的解决方法
Aug 02 Javascript
微信小程序 教程之条件渲染
Oct 18 Javascript
基于Bootstrap模态对话框只加载一次 remote 数据的解决方法
Jul 09 Javascript
浅入深出Vue之自动化路由
Aug 06 Javascript
小程序跨页面交互的作用与方法详解
Jan 07 Javascript
Vue组件间的通信pubsub-js实现步骤解析
Mar 11 Javascript
浅析jQuery中调用ajax方法时在不同浏览器中遇到的问题
Jun 11 #Javascript
控制文字内容的显示与隐藏示例
Jun 11 #Javascript
用js一次改变多个input的readonly属性值的方法
Jun 11 #Javascript
jQuery队列操作方法实例
Jun 11 #Javascript
JS生成不重复随机数组的函数代码
Jun 10 #Javascript
JS 在指定数组中随机取出N个不重复的数据
Jun 10 #Javascript
JS生成随机字符串的多种方法
Jun 10 #Javascript
You might like
一台收音机,让一家人都笑逐颜开!
2020/08/21 无线电
PHP实现的功能是显示8条基色色带
2006/10/09 PHP
php判断字符以及字符串的包含方法属性
2008/08/30 PHP
如何利用php array_multisort函数 对数据库结果进行复杂排序
2013/06/08 PHP
php登陆页的密码处理方式分享
2013/10/14 PHP
javascript 哈希表(hashtable)的简单实现
2010/01/20 Javascript
js网页侧边随页面滚动广告效果实现
2011/04/14 Javascript
JavaScript高级程序设计阅读笔记(五) ECMAScript中的运算符(一)
2012/02/27 Javascript
JavaScript高级程序设计 读书笔记之十 本地对象Date日期
2012/02/27 Javascript
jQuery获取当前对象标签名称的方法
2014/02/07 Javascript
js实现select跳转功能代码
2014/10/22 Javascript
JS更改select内option属性的方法
2015/10/14 Javascript
jQuery动态添加及删除表单上传元素的方法(附demo源码下载)
2016/01/15 Javascript
jquery-mobile基础属性与用法详解
2016/11/23 Javascript
JavaScript计时器用法分析【setTimeout和clearTimeout】
2017/01/18 Javascript
Vue实例简单方法介绍
2017/01/20 Javascript
jQuery插件HighCharts绘制简单2D折线图效果示例【附demo源码】
2017/03/21 jQuery
vue计算属性computed、事件、监听器watch的使用讲解
2019/01/21 Javascript
create-react-app中添加less支持的实现
2019/11/15 Javascript
three.js 如何制作魔方
2020/07/31 Javascript
[03:57]2016完美“圣”典风云人物:rOtk专访
2016/12/09 DOTA
python3抓取中文网页的方法
2015/07/28 Python
Python collections中的双向队列deque简单介绍详解
2019/11/04 Python
django有外键关系的两张表如何相互查找
2020/02/10 Python
pycharm新建Vue项目的方法步骤(图文)
2020/03/04 Python
html5桌面通知(Web Notifications)实例解析
2014/07/07 HTML / CSS
保洁主管岗位职责
2013/11/20 职场文书
小学毕业感言500字
2014/02/28 职场文书
七一建党节演讲稿
2014/09/11 职场文书
公司法人授权委托书范本
2014/09/12 职场文书
2014年教务处工作总结
2014/12/03 职场文书
毕业典礼邀请函
2015/01/31 职场文书
2015年司法所工作总结
2015/04/27 职场文书
python实现简单反弹球游戏
2021/04/12 Python
JavaScript如何优化逻辑判断代码详解
2021/06/08 Javascript
mysql使用FIND_IN_SET和group_concat两个方法查询上下级机构
2022/04/20 MySQL